    Product Information

    Konami's vampire-hunting series begins anew with Lords of Shadow. As a descendant of the famed Belmont family, you must vanquish an assortment of dark creatures to save the world from an insidious curse. Gabriel Belmont must explore more than 50 stages, each viewed from a third-person perspective, using over 40 possible combo attacks to defeat his enemies. To progress, you'll need to swing across chasms, climb walls, rappel down cliffs, and overcome various dangers lurking within the gothic ruins, castles, forests, swamps, and tundra making up the game's Southern Europe setting.<br><br>Gabriel will rely on daggers, holy water, and a multi-functional "combat cross" to repel his supernatural foes. A retractable chain whip is housed within the cross, allowing Gabriel to swing from ledges and to attack enemies from afar. Throughout your travels, you'll solve puzzles to unlock new items, battle large-scale bosses, and harness the power of magic. Created by Spanish developer Mercury Steam under the supervision of Kojima Productions, Lords of Shadow features Hollywood-style cinematics and professional voice acting from Robert Carlyle, Patrick Stewart, Natasha McElhone, and Jason Issacs.
